--------------------------------------------------------------------- APNIC 18 Policy SIG summary
1. Overview
There were 3 sessions to cover 10 presentations including 4 proposals. 93 attendees in Session 1, 92 in Session 2, 70 in Session 3. Yong Wan Ju stepped down from co-chair, and Toshiyuki Hosaka was elected to the new co-chair.
Several rough consensus were reached as described in section 2. in this summary.
2. Proposals
(1) prop-023-v001: proposal to prevent the routing of "dark" address space
- Proposal summary: To withdraw address space from LIR who routes "dark" prefix.
- Consensus was not reached.
(2) prop-020-v001: Application of the HD ratio to IPv4
- Proposal summary: To apply HD ratio as IPv4 subsequent allocation criteria.
- There was no clear consensus.
- Consensus is to keep this proposal open. APNIC secretariat and NIRs to do a small survey on ISP address management problems.
(3) prop-021-v001: Expansion of the initial allocation space for existing IPv6 address space holders
- Proposal summary: To expand IPv6 address space for existing IPv6 address holders without satisfying the subsequent allocation requirements, with IPv6 deployment plan and/or with IPv4 infrastructure information.
- Consensus was reached.
(4) prop-005-v003: Internet Assigned Numbers Authority (IANA) policy for allocation of IPv6 blocks to Regional Internet Registries
- Proposal summary: IPv6 Policy from IANA to RIRs
- Consensus reached for the revised proposal, with some flexibility of parameters. Flexibility is left for consensus of other regions
- Specific number of parameters will be discussed in ML
3. Informational Presentations
6 informational presentations were made. - IPv6 address space management - IPv6 policy status from ARIN, LACNIC, RIPE and APNIC communities - Unique Local IPv6 unicast addresses - Large space IPv4 trial usage program for future IPv6 deployment activities update vol.7 - Status report on APNIC policy implementations from APNIC 17 - IPv6 address assignment size for end-users
